What do you know about the signs of two intergers whose product (a) positive and (b) negative?

Mathematics
2 answers:
Fynjy0 [20]3 years ago
8 0
( + ) ( - ) = ( - )
steposvetlana [31]3 years ago
5 0
A. Their signs are the same.
b. one is negative, the other is positive

Justin spends $21.75 on 6 rides and three sodas for his friends. Jerry spends $39.50 on 10 rides and 6 sodas for his friends. Ho
SIZIF [17.4K]
R = rides
S = sodas

6R + 3S = $21.75 —> -12R - 6S = -43.5
10R + 6S = $39.50–>10R + 6S = 39.5

Multiplying Justin’s whole equation by -2 will bring out the 6S’, so we can focus on the cost of one ride.

-2R = -4
Divide both sides by -2
So for one ride, it would cost $2.

To find the cost for one soda, we plug in the cost for a ride.

6(2) + 3S = $21.75
12 + 3S = $21.75
3S = $9.75
So for one soda, it would cost $3.25.
